On the record
That to make all traffic just and equal, it is indispensable that, in each separate purchase and sale, the money paid should be a bona fide equivalent of the labor or property bought with it.
Said by
Lysander Spooner

Editor's note · Context

This statement emphasizes the necessity of fair exchange in transactions to ensure justice.
